What Is a Flexible Strip Brush?

A flexible strip brush replaces the rigid metal channel with a bendable polymer backing. It can follow curved edges, irregular openings, and shaped equipment where a straight metal-backed strip brush cannot fit easily. Flexible strips can be supplied in continuous coils or cut lengths, depending on the construction and profile.

Flexible Strip Brush Constructions

Select the retention method and backing structure before confirming the profile, filament, trim, and supply length.

Fused extruded flexible strip brush supplied in a continuous coil

Fused / extruded flexible strip brushes

  • Fused construction: Filaments are fused directly into a continuous extruded backing.
  • Materials: PP or nylon filament with flexible PP or nylon backing.
  • Trim range: 20–300 mm.
  • Continuous length: Extruded backing can be produced up to 250 m.
  • Working form: Metal-free, corrosion-resistant when chemically compatible, and able to follow curved or irregular contours.
  • Configuration: A fused construction can provide a dense, continuous filament line.
Tufted flexible-profile strip brush with filament bundles secured in a rubber profile

Tufted flexible-profile strip brushes

  • A flexible profile is formed first, then filament bundles are tufted into it.
  • Nylon or PP filament can be tufted into flexible rubber, TPE, or TPV profiles.
  • Custom tuft-hole spacing: Closer spacing increases density and can improve sealing contact.
  • Row count, fill density, and contact pattern can be adjusted.
  • Suitable for larger profiles and clip-on or shaped mounting sections.
  • Spray-suppression versions can use Clip-on, square, H, or F profiles, typically in 25 m rolls.

Rotary Heat Exchanger Seal Brushes

Flexible seal brushes fit around the heat-wheel perimeter and internal crossbars to reduce air bypass and help maintain heat-recovery performance.

  • PVC mounting base: Flexible carrier with optional mounting holes.
  • BCF yarn bristles: Primary flexible sealing contact.
  • Central plastic sealing fin: Supplements the bristle contact.
  • Reinforced adhesive: Supports bristle retention.
  • Roll packaging: Reduces shipping space before installation.

Profile and Mounting Options

Plain flexible backing: Coils, cut lengths, and curved paths.

Clip-on profile: Grips a compatible sheet-metal or panel edge.

H, F, Y, and square profiles: Defined mounting faces for selected assemblies.

Front- or side-tufted: Positions contact to match the installation direction.

Straight strips: Linear paths and cut-length installations.

Spiral / coiled forms: Preformed for circular or helical paths.

Custom profile: Developed from a drawing when a standard section does not fit.

Backing and Filament Materials

Flexible backing

  • Flexible PP or nylon for fused / extruded strips
  • TPE, TPV, TPU, PVC, EPDM, silicone, thermoplastic rubber, rubber, or flexible PP for selected profiles
  • PVC mounting base for rotary heat-exchanger seal brushes

Filament

  • PP or nylon: General sealing, guiding, wiping, and spray control
  • Horsehair or tampico: Softer contact and light dusting
  • Steel wire: Selected contact duties after surface and retention review
  • BCF yarn: Rotary heat-exchanger seal brushes with a central plastic fin

Selected TPE / TPV constructions

  • Typical working-temperature reference: −60°C to 135°C
  • UV, ozone, and anti-aging performance depends on the selected grade and project requirements
  • Material grade, hardness, filament diameter, and environmental performance are confirmed per application

FAQ

What is the difference between a flexible strip brush and a metal channel strip brush?

A flexible strip brush uses a bendable polymer backing for curved or irregular paths. A metal channel strip brush uses a rigid metal carrier and is better suited to straight sections or formed metal profiles.

What is the difference between fused and tufted flexible strip brushes?

Fused strips bond the filament into a continuous extruded backing. Tufted strips secure individual filament bundles in a flexible profile, allowing the row count and tuft spacing to be adjusted.

Can flexible strip brushes be supplied in rolls?

Yes. Continuous coils and cut lengths are available for selected constructions. Coiling for packaging is different from a preformed spiral or helical brush, which requires inside diameter, outside diameter, pitch, rotation direction, and overall length.

Can a flexible strip brush follow any curve?

The allowable curve depends on the backing material, cross-section, bend direction, and trim. Send the installation path or drawing so the minimum bend radius can be checked.

What information is needed for a custom flexible strip brush?

Provide the profile or mounting space, length, curve, filament, trim, working environment, and quantity. A drawing or sample is helpful when the section is non-standard.
